Chapels encourage and challenge students

Every Wednesday, the entire student body and staff of Redeemer gathers in our gym for worship, prayer, and reflection. Our student-led worship team leads the singing which is then followed by a presentation.

Our speakers include teachers, pastors or youth pastors, missionaries and people working for Christian ministries or organizations. Presentations may also be made by community members or even students who would like to share about a mission experience, or promote a Christian organization or event.

Our weekly chapel is an important ingredient in our school schedule; it’s an opportunity to challenge our students’ faith walk, to introduce them to new ideas, and a time for them to hear God’s Word.
